Evaluate the function.<br> f(t)=-2t - 1; Find f(-9)
castortr0y [4]

Answer:

17

Step-by-step explanation:

substitute t = - 9 into f(t) , that is

f(- 9) = - 2(- 9) - 1 = 18 - 1 = 17
